    11 EN Pair and connect Option 1: Pair and connect thr ough NFC Near Field Communication (NFC) is a technology that enables shor t-range wireless communication betw een various NFC compatible devices, such as mobile phones and IC tags. With the NFC function, data communication can be achieved easily just b y touching the relevant symbol or designate ...
